Festival Presentation Impakt Online 2009!Friday 16 October 2009 / 19:00 / Theater Kikker , Utrecht, The Netherlands Internet is often considered as “timeless”, an endless space of connected websites and data files, a media sphere where users can wander about blindly, unaware of time. At the same time we face a growing proliferation of spam, dead links, pop-ups and search queries that lead nowhere. How to define the experience and perception of time spent online? When is information “fresh”? How do trends develop on the Web? How fast do they wear of? These are the issues addressed by the projects curated by Sabine Niederer for Impakt Online. During the Impakt Festival, these online art projects will be presented in the presence of some of the artists. Theo Deutinger (AU) will present “World at Work”, a multilayered visualisation of people’s work patterns in different time zones, in the form of a world clock. Daan Odijk (NL) is one of the developers of “A Tag’s Life”, a project that researches the rise and fall of tags on the basis of data collected from Flickr. Richard Rogers (NL) will speak about the IP-browser, which only allows to surf on close-by IP addresses. A form of “slow browsing” which opens new perspectives on the Web. Constant Dullaart (NL) will share his collection of web pages – or “ready-mades” as he calls them – situated in the far out limits of the Web: domains for sale that no one wants to buy and dumps of Internet junk.
